Poaching of wildlife in a Zimbabwean conservancy harms the country chiefly because it

Aincreases the grazing left over for cattle on the neighbouring farms
Bforces the game rangers to move the herds onto a new grazing block
Craises the cost of maintaining the game fence right round the conservancy
Dcuts the number of animals that draw tourists and earn foreign currency
Explanation: Wildlife is an agricultural and tourism resource, and a conservancy earns from photographic tourism, hunting and the sale of game meat. Every animal taken illegally is income lost to the country and to the community that shares in it.
